Advanced Search

CHINA_Wed, 2026-03-11 00:00

Transaction Date: 
Wednesday, March 11, 2026
TT: 
6.6402
DD: 
6.5806
Buying: 
6.3869
Selling: 
7.1768
Selling Notes: 
7.2948
Country: